McClelland's Theories
McClelland's Theories focus on human motivation, particularly the needs for achievement, power, and affiliation and their impact on human behavior.
Herzberg's Theories
A motivational theory, which distinguishes between hygiene factors that can prevent dissatisfaction, and motivators that can lead to satisfaction in the workplace.
Employee Engagement
The level of enthusiasm and dedication a worker feels towards their job, characterized by emotional attachment and willingness to go above and beyond.
Financial Performance
A measurement of how well an entity is using its assets to generate earnings, often evaluated through indicators like revenue, profit, and return on investment.
